#1c1d8d basic color information

#1c1d8d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1c1d8d has decimal index of: 1842573, is composed of 11% red, 11.4% green and 55.3% blue. #1c1d8d in CMYK color model, is composed of 80.1%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black.
#333399 is the closest web-safe color to #1c1d8d.

#1c1d8d color details and conversion

The hexadecimal triplet #1c1d8d definition is: Red = 28, Green = 29, Blue = 141 or CMYK: Cyan = 0.80141843971631, Magenta = 0.79432624113475, Yellow = 0, Black = 0.44705882352941
